The popular shark attack movie franchise is returning for another installment, and there are already a ton of exciting updates about 47 Meters Down 3. In 2017’s 47 Meters Down, sisters Lisa (Mandy Moore) and Kate (Claire Holt) struggle to maintain their sanity after being trapped underwater in a diving cage among sharks. 47 Meters Down: Uncaged tells an entirely new story as its characters explore an underwater city and are once again attacked by bloodthirsty sharks. Though the shark attack genre is hardly new, the 47 Meters Down franchise has brought it into the 21st century.

Critically speaking, both 47 Meters Down films have been somewhat poorly received by critics, and though they’re better than the cheesiest shark attack movies, they’re hardly high art as well. Fortunately, they have proven to be hits at the box office, and their low budget has kept the profit margin high between 47 Meters Down and its 2019 sequel. Now, plans are in place to bring the shark madness back to the big screen, and 47 Meters Down 3 is already in the works.

47 Meters Down 3 Latest News

A Production Window Is Revealed

Announcing everything at once, the latest news surrounding the threequel confirms that 47 Meters Down 3 is happening and a production window is also revealed. Long speculated since the success of 2019’s 47 Meters Down: Uncaged, the third film in the shark attack series is slated to begin filming in fall 2024 and will be directed by Patrick Lussier (Dracula 2000). Series creator Johannes Roberts will pen the script alongside screenwriter Ernest Riera. This will be the first film in the series not directed by Roberts, and no cast information has been revealed.

47 Meters Down 3 Production Status

The Movie Is Slated To Shoot In Fall 2024

Though a release date won’t be revealed for quite some time, the newly announced 47 Meters Down threequel has already dropped news regarding its production timeline. Since 47 Meters Down 3 is scheduled to begin filming in fall 2024, it’s a safe bet that the studio is aiming for a summer 2025 release window. 47 Meters Down 3 Story Details

A Father-Daughter Team Is Attacked By Sharks

While all the details haven’t been announced yet, the basic framework of 47 Meters Down 3 has already been revealed. Like it’s predecessor, the threequel will tell an entirely new story with new characters that pit them against a gaggle of blood-thirsty great white sharks. The film will follow a father and daughter diving team who are investigating a shipwreck in the deep ocean. Unfortunately for them, they become trapped by killer sharks and must try to survive with a dwindling oxygen supply.

Though the plot sounds eerily reminiscent to that of 47 Meters Down: Uncaged, it has also been announced that the threequel will feature family drama as the father and daughter try to reconnect. Perhaps 47 Meters Down 3 could introduce the family dynamic which will make the audience care more for the characters, and it will give them something bigger to fight for besides simple survival.
